App-CPANtoRPM
    
    
  
  
  
view release on metacpan or search on metacpan
lib/App/CPANtoRPM.pm view on Meta::CPAN
use Config;
$ARCH  = $Config{'archname'};
$VERS  = $Config{'version'};
###############################################################################
# GLOBAL VARIABLES
###############################################################################
our $TMPDIR     = "/tmp/cpantorpm";
our %Macros     = (0 => {
                         '_optimize'  => '$RPM_OPT_FLAGS',
                         '_buildroot' => '$RPM_BUILD_ROOT',
                        },
                   1 => {
                         '_optimize'  => '%{optimize}',
                         '_buildroot' => '%{buildroot}',
                        }
                  );
    
  
  
  lib/App/CPANtoRPM.pm view on Meta::CPAN
   $package{'epoch'}   = $$self{'epoch'}  if ($$self{'epoch'} ne '');
   $package{'group'}   = $$self{'group'};
   $package{'license'} = ($package{'m_license'} ?
                          $package{'m_license'} :
                          'GPL+ or Artistic');
   $package{'source'} =
     ($package{'from'} eq 'CPAN' ?
      "http://search.cpan.org/authors/id/$package{cpandir}/$package{archive}" :
      $package{'fromsrc'} );
   foreach my $key (keys %{ $Macros{$$self{'macros'}} }) {
      my $val = $Macros{$$self{'macros'}}{$key};
      $package{$key} = $val;
   }
   #
   # Find out if there are is a post-build script.
   #
   $self->_post_build();
   #
    
  
  
  
( run in 0.252 second using v1.01-cache-2.11-cpan-0a6323c29d9 )